Information about Isla Mujeres, Mexico

Isla Mujeres Mexico hotels Isla Mujeres is a privileged place with a unique natural and cultural wealth in Mexico. Located just a few miles from the shore of Cancun, in the Quintana Roo State. This beautiful island combines the beauty of the Caribbean, the dense tropical jungle and the wonderful heritage of the Mayan civilization. It stands out as one of Mexico's natural treasures, a truly delightful paradise on earth.

In addition to its beaches and the stunning natural architecture of its cliffs, Isla Mujeres has archaeological vestiges and marine parks with incredible natural reefs. Activities & attractions in Isla Mujeres
Isla Mujeres offers unique options for water activities, from windsurfing to admiring the wonderful coral reefs while snorkeling, to diving the underwater paradise of El Garrafon National Park, the impressive cave of the sleeping sharks and reefs such as Farito, Islaché and Manchones. On the white and fine sand beaches of Playa Norte, you can enjoy the air, the sun and the water, and it is a perfect place for those who practice yoga, since at dawn they can get full of energy and at sunset a complete peace invades them. On the other end of the island, on a cliff known as Punta Sur, there is a temple the Maya used to worship goddess Ixchel. Furthermore, Isla Mujeres has a continental part with a new development, Costa Mujeres; El Meco, a Mayan archaeological site and Boca Iglesias, the birthplace of this tourist destination.

Ecoturism in Isla Mujeres
On Isla Mujeres, ecotourism is an active part of the tourist industry, where you can find places for nature and adventure lovers. You can visit protected areas such as Contoy Island or the Birds' Island, where you will learn how to respect the environment, since it is a natural reserve that has become the most important home to marine birds on the Mexican Caribbean. You can enjoy the adventure of ecotourism by visiting diving sites such as the Cave of the Sleeping Sharks, Cuevones, Half Moon and Barracuda Valley, which will provide an unforgettable experience and your best adventure ever.

Scuba diving in Isla Mujeres
Isla Mujeres is famous for its extraordinary diving sites, especially El Garrafón, Farito and Manchones. Thanks to its crystal-clear waters, it is possible to admire the marine fauna and corals that range from three to five meters high. Around the island, there are several attractive sites for diving, such as The Cross of the Bay, Los Cuevones, Lavandera Reef and the Cave of the Sleeping Sharks. These reefs are excellent both for beginner and advanced divers, since the sea is calm and the water very clear.

Turtle Farm
Isla Mujeres has been home to the giant sea turtles that lay their eggs on its soft sand from May to September. During many years, sea turtles were killed for their meat, shell and eggs, but now they are protected by Mexican Federal Laws. Eggs are deposited in protected areas to keep them safe from predators. After they are born, the turtles are transferred to ponds and then taken to the sea by the local school children and tourists who help them return to their natural habitat.

Seeing hundreds of sea turtles that survive thanks to the care and love of the islanders is a unique experience and an example for the rest of the world. Isla Mujeres' turtle farm is located on the southern part of the island, and supported by Mexican government and private funds.

Sleeping Sharks
About 50 years ago, a young man from the island, Carlos García Castilla, found a deep cave in the sea where the sharks entered, but did not get out. Curiosity made him dive about 65 feet and he found out that the sharks were sleeping with their eyes wide open. He had just discovered the cave of the sleeping sharks, located 30 minutes by boat from the island, where you can watch the strange phenomenon of the sharks that remain motionless for hours. It is an excellent place to practice high level diving and witness this astounding natural feat.

Boat tours
The boat tours will allow you to discover interesting places close to the island and admire beautiful corals and a great variety of marine species. Boat tours are ideal to practice snorkeling, get to know nurse sharks and try Isla Mujeres´ official specialty, a delicious and traditional fish recipe, “Tikinxic”. Boats leave all day long from the fishing cooperatives along Rueda Medina, the island’s main street.
